%PDF- %PDF-
Mini Shell

Mini Shell

Direktori : /snap/core/17212/usr/lib/python3/dist-packages/yaml/__pycache__/
Upload File :
Create Path :
Current File : //snap/core/17212/usr/lib/python3/dist-packages/yaml/__pycache__/error.cpython-35.pyc



U"3S�	�@sRdddgZGdd�d�ZGdd�de�ZGdd�de�ZdS)�Mark�	YAMLError�MarkedYAMLErrorc@s:eZdZdd�Zdddd�Zdd�Zd	S)
rcCs:||_||_||_||_||_||_dS)N)�name�index�line�column�buffer�pointer)�selfrrrrrr	�r�,/usr/lib/python3/dist-packages/yaml/error.py�__init__s					z
Mark.__init__��KcCsB|jdkrdSd}|j}x]|dkr�|j|ddkr�|d8}|j||ddkr%d}|d7}Pq%Wd}|j}xb|t|j�kr�|j|dkr�|d7}||j|ddkr�d}|d8}Pq�W|j||�}d||||d	d||j|t|�d
S)N���u
…

�z ... �� �
�^)rr	�len)r
�indentZ
max_length�head�start�tail�end�snippetrrr�get_snippets(	&

	+

zMark.get_snippetcCsN|j�}d|j|jd|jdf}|dk	rJ|d|7}|S)Nz  in "%s", line %d, column %drz:
)rrrr)r
rZwhererrr�__str__%s!zMark.__str__N)�__name__�
__module__�__qualname__r
rr rrrrrsc@seZdZdS)rN)r!r"r#rrrrr-sc@s7eZdZddddddd�Zdd�ZdS)rNcCs1||_||_||_||_||_dS)N)�context�context_mark�problem�problem_mark�note)r
r$r%r&r'r(rrrr
2s
				zMarkedYAMLError.__init__cCs g}|jdk	r%|j|j�|jdk	r�|jdks�|jdks�|jj|jjks�|jj|jjks�|jj|jjkr�|jt|j��|jdk	r�|j|j�|jdk	r�|jt|j��|j	dk	r|j|j	�dj
|�S)Nr)r$�appendr%r&r'rrr�strr(�join)r
�linesrrrr :s zMarkedYAMLError.__str__)r!r"r#r
r rrrrr0sN)�__all__r�	Exceptionrrrrrr�<module>s)

Zerion Mini Shell 1.0